Bulb: A grow light bulb is the most important component of a grow light system, providing the necessary light for plants to photosynthesize and grow. Choose a bulb that emits the right spectrum of light for your plants’ needs.
Reflector: A reflector helps to direct and focus the light from your bulb onto your plants, maximizing its effectiveness. Look for one with an adjustable angle so you can adjust it as needed throughout the growing season.
Ballast: The ballast regulates the current flowing through your bulb, ensuring it operates safely and efficiently at all times. Make sure you choose one that is compatible with your chosen bulb type and wattage rating.
Timer: A timer allows you to control when your lights turn on and off automatically, making it easier to maintain consistent lighting conditions in your grow space without having to manually switch them on or off each day or night cycle.
Hangers/Mounts: You’ll need some way of suspending or mounting your lights above your plants in order to get optimal coverage from them – look for adjustable hangers/mounts that will allow you to easily adjust their height as needed throughout the growing season
